Try to wirte the algorithm of heap sort
WebJun 13, 2024 · HEAPSORT (A, N): An array A with N elements is given. This algorithm sorts the element of A. [Build a heap A ,using a procedure 1] Repeat for J=1 to N-1. Call … WebJul 4, 2024 · Implementation of the Heap Sort algorithm in C++. I'm writing a little collection of sorting algorithms and some benchmarks (using Google benchmark). I wrote the …
Try to wirte the algorithm of heap sort
Did you know?
WebAnalysis of Heapsort. The analysis of the code is simple. There is a while loop which is running n times and each time it is executing 3 statements. The first two statements ( … WebMar 21, 2024 · A Sorting Algorithm is used to rearrange a given array or list of elements according to a comparison operator on the elements. The comparison operator is used to …
WebJun 25, 2024 · The process is repeated for the remaining elements.To complete the sorting, the algorithm requires 3 steps: With input data, create a heap. The heap’s elements are … WebLet’s understand the Heap Sort Program in C by the given steps: 1. Print the unsorted array. 2. Creating the binary heap of the array. 3. Start iteration from the last leaf node of the …
WebThe Heap sort algorithm to arrange a list of elements in ascending order is performed using following steps... Step 1 - Construct a Binary Tree with given list of Elements. Step 2 - … WebJul 2, 2024 · Algorithm: Build a heap out of the data set. Remove the largest item and place it at the end of the sorted array. After removing the largest item, reconstruct the heap and …
WebIn this article, we will discuss the Heapsort Algorithm. Heap sort processes the elements by creating the min-heap or max-heap using the elements of the given array. Min-heap or …
WebHeap-Sort . Sorting Strategy: 1. Build Max Heap from unordered array; 2. Find maximum element A[1]; 3. Swap elements A[n] and A[1]: now max element is at the end of the array! … shutdown blackpink chordsWebHeap sort algorithm is divided into two basic parts: Creating a Heap of the unsorted list/array. Then a sorted array is created by repeatedly removing the largest/smallest element from the heap, and inserting it into the array. … the owl house tv kingWebAug 19, 2024 · Write a Python program to sort a list of elements using Heap sort. In computer science, heapsort (invented by J. W. J. Williams in 1964) is a comparison-based … shut down bittorrentWebHeap Sort . Heaps can be used in sorting an array. In max-heaps, maximum element will always be at the root. Heap Sort uses this property of heap to sort the array. Consider an array $$ Arr $$ which is to be sorted using … shut down blackpink classical musicWebEnroll for Free. This course covers basics of algorithm design and analysis, as well as algorithms for sorting arrays, data structures such as priority queues, hash functions, and applications such as Bloom filters. Algorithms for Searching, Sorting, and Indexing can be taken for academic credit as part of CU Boulder’s Master of Science in ... shutdown biosWebHeap Sort. Given an array of size N. The task is to sort the array elements by completing functions heapify() and buildHeap() which are used to implement Heap Sort. Input: N = 5 … shut down blackpink bpmWebMar 12, 2024 · 1) Using the Scanner class method nextInt (), read the entered numbers and store the numbers into the array a []. 2) In the heap tree every parent node should not … shut down blackpink ccl